What is with the Giants tho they had Graham in yesterday and Kafka no contracts signed, Bienemy is interviewing leaving the door open for Kafka to return to the Chiefs without pen to paper. Not sure about comp picks for coordinators making lateral moves. This is the wording of the applicable section of the rule: (ii) The employer-club shall be eligible to receive this Draft choice compensation if: a. The minority employee hired as a Head Coach or Primary Football Executive has been employed by the employer-club for a minimum of two full seasons; and b. The minority employee is not the Head Coach or Primary Football Executive of the employer-club and is hired into the same position with the new club. There can be no break in employment between clubs. It would seem that Graham would be covered under section (ii)-b
